Tips for Handling Discomfort During and After Therapy
Managing discomfort throughout and after soft Tissue therapy can substantially boost your general experience and healing.
To begin, interact honestly with your therapist regarding your pain levels; they can adjust strategies accordingly. Using deep breathing strategies can likewise assist you relax and reduce discomfort.
Think about using ice to the cured area post-session to reduce inflammation and numb soreness. Remaining hydrated aids in the healing process, so drink lots of water.
Gentle stretching and light activity after treatment can promote blood circulation and simplicity rigidity. Last but not least, ensure you obtain sufficient remainder to permit your body to recover.
Executing these suggestions can make your soft Tissue treatment much more workable and satisfying.
